Evansville

Evansville

When you are hungry or parched from a long day on the trail, the friendly community of Evansville (half-way between Alexandria and Fergus Falls) has several ways to help you satisfy your needs.

If your water bottle is empty, you can stop by the historic fountain on the east end of town to fill your bottle free of charge.  Evansville was voted the best tasting water in Minnesota in 2020.  (The new water drinking fountains are scheduled to be installed in the spring/summer of 2021.)

While in town, take a few minutes to check out the Evansville Historical Foundation and Pioneer Village, a representation of how people have lived in west central Minnesota over the past 100+ years.

In the heart of the community, and just off the trail’s edge, there are several businesses where you can stop for food or beverages.  Schatzi’s for breakfast or lunch, Backroads for a burger or an ice cold beer, and the Evansville Meat Market for excellent snacks.

Other businesses that may be of interest while passing through town would be two convenience stores/gas stations, these are Hiway Amoco and Lon’s Spur.  Evansville Hardware is a full-line Hardware Hank franchise and also has an extensive line of sporting goods.  The Main Street Market is a new 24-hour grocery store concept that will be opening in the summer of 2021.

Another point of interest would be the Evansville Art Center.  A local non-profit group whose mission is to provide access to the arts for all ages.  This includes music, photography, poetry, pottery, carving, and many other offerings from local artists.

All of these businesses are within one block of the trail.  We hope that you enjoy the beautiful scenery and friendly people while passing through our community.
